State Bill Number Date Position Title Status
WI SB 428 2023-09-08 OPPOSE Allows minors 16 years old and older to consent to vaccines without parents' knowledge or consent, also allows same minor to consent to bill insurance Status: Referred to Senate Committee on Health on 9/8/2023

Action: Contact members of Senate Committee on Health, your Senator, & Representative, ask to OPPOSE
WI AB 229/SB 228 2023-06-07 SUPPORT Prohibits DHS from mandating new vaccines past 1/1/2023 and adds exemption for school varicella vaccine mandate based on prior infection Status: AB 229 referred to committee on Health, Aging and Long-Term Care on 6/7/2023, SB 228 referred to Senate Committee on Administrative Rules on 6/7/2023
